In this episode, Vincent sits down with author and artist Chris Panatier to discuss his haunting novel, The Redemption of Morgan Bright — a psychological horror story that explores identity, grief, institutional abuse, and the terrifying blur between reality and delusion. Recorded just after their meeting at the Ghoulish Book Festival, the conversation dives deep into the novel’s inspirations, including the Victorian-era treatment of women, mind control theories like MK-Ultra, and the disturbing real-life history of psychiatric care.

Chris reveals how Roe v. Wade’s overturning reshaped the book’s trajectory, how legal experience informs his worldview, and what it’s like to write horror in a world where reality keeps outpacing fiction. They also discuss the use of epistolary storytelling, the symbolic significance of butterflies, and how psychological horror offers a unique — and terrifyingly intimate — reading experience.
